Requirements
- 5+ years of hands-on Salesforce administration experience, ideally in a B2B SaaS or technology company.
- Salesforce Administrator Certification required.
- Proven experience supporting global or multi-regional Salesforce deployments with complex user bases and data models.
- Hands-on experience with Salesforce Experience Cloud, including building and managing portals.
- Strong proficiency with Salesforce automation tools including Flow, Process Builder, and Workflow Rules.
- Experience with Salesforce integrations (e.g., HubSpot/Marketo, Slack, Docusign, Snowflake).
- Experience with Salesforce reporting and dashboards for revenue operations and forecasting.
- Experience leading or participating in User Acceptance Testing (UAT).
- Excellent communication skills and ability to collaborate with technical and non-technical stakeholders across time zones.
- Strong attention to detail and ability to manage multiple priorities in a high-growth environment.
Responsibilities
- Own day-to-day administration of Salesforce (Sales Cloud, CPQ, Experience Cloud) including user management, profiles, roles, and security settings.
- Design, build, and maintain workflows, custom objects, and reports to support global go-to-market operations.
- Partner with stakeholders to gather requirements and translate business needs into scalable Salesforce solutions.
- Manage and improve data quality through deduplication, cleansing, and implementation of data governance best practices.
- Administer integrations between Salesforce and third-party tools such as Slack, marketing automation, and AI platforms.
- Lead and coordinate User Acceptance Testing (UAT) for new features and releases, including script writing and defect tracking.
- Maintain system documentation and provide training to sales teams.
